How to Select the Right Pressure Transmitter 4-20mA for Your Factory
When selecting the right pressure transmitter 4-20mA for your factory, it is important to consider the application, accuracy, range, and environmental conditions. Here are some tips to help you make the right choice.
1. Application: The first step is to determine the application for which the pressure transmitter 4-20mA will be used. This will help you determine the type of pressure transmitter that is best suited for your needs.
2. Accuracy: The accuracy of the pressure transmitter is an important factor to consider. The accuracy of the pressure transmitter should be within the range of the application.
3. Range: The range of the pressure transmitter should be appropriate for the application. The range should be wide enough to cover the expected pressure range.
4. Environmental Conditions: The environmental conditions should also be taken into consideration when selecting the right pressure transmitter 4-20mA. The pressure transmitter should be able to withstand the temperature, humidity, and other environmental conditions of the application.
By following these tips, you can ensure that you select the right pressure transmitter 4-20mA for your factory. With the right pressure transmitter, you can ensure that your factory runs smoothly and efficiently.
Understanding the Benefits of Pressure Transmitter 4-20mA for Industrial Automation
Industrial automation is a rapidly growing field, and pressure transmitters are an essential component of many automated systems. Pressure transmitters are used to measure and monitor pressure in a variety of industrial applications, from process control to safety systems. The 4-20mA pressure transmitter is one of the most popular types of pressure transmitters, and it offers a number of advantages for industrial automation.
The 4-20mA pressure transmitter is a two-wire device that is designed to be used in a loop circuit. This type of transmitter is powered by the loop circuit, and it sends a signal back to the controller. The signal is a 4-20mA current, which is proportional to the pressure being measured. This type of transmitter is highly accurate and reliable, and it is easy to install and maintain.

One of the main advantages of the 4-20mA pressure transmitter is its accuracy. This type of transmitter is designed to be highly accurate, and it can measure pressure with a high degree of precision. This makes it ideal for applications where accuracy is critical, such as process control.
Another advantage of the 4-20mA pressure transmitter is its flexibility. This type of transmitter can be used in a variety of applications, from process control to safety systems. It is also compatible with a wide range of controllers, making it easy to integrate into existing systems.
The 4-20mA pressure transmitter is also easy to install and maintain. This type of transmitter is designed to be easy to install and maintain, and it requires minimal wiring. This makes it ideal for applications where installation and maintenance costs need to be kept to a minimum.
The 4-20mA pressure transmitter is an essential component of many industrial automation systems. It is highly accurate, flexible, and easy to install and maintain, making it an ideal choice for a variety of applications. With its many advantages, the 4-20mA pressure transmitter is an invaluable tool for industrial automation.
